We are seeking an experienced P&C Operations Manager to partner closely with executive leadership and operational teams to drive the delivery of People & Culture operations and oversee the execution of core HR functions across the business.
The role provides both operational leadership and hands‐on management across HR operations, employee relations, workforce planning, reporting, and systems. You will act as a trusted partner to senior leaders, ensuring people practices align with business objectives while maintaining compliance with Australian employment legislation.
The role will also play a key role in supporting organisational growth, managing workforce transitions, and fostering a high‐performance and positive workplace culture. It will strengthen systems and processes, improve operational efficiency, and use workforce data and insights to support informed decision‐making.
Duties
P&C Operations & Business Partnering
Partner with senior leaders to align P&C delivery with business objectives
Lead and manage end‐to‐end HR operations (onboarding, contracts, lifecycle)
Establish structured processes, workflows, and templates
Ensure consistent and high‐quality delivery of core P&C activities
Strategic HR & Leadership Support
Provide advice and coaching on workforce planning, organisational design, and talent development
Lead people initiatives to strengthen engagement, performance, and capability
Drive continuous improvement across HR processes, systems, and ways of working
Employee Relations & Performance
Act as a trusted advisor on complex employee relations matters, including investigations, grievances, and disciplinary processes
Support and embed performance management frameworks
Coach leaders on performance, development, and workplace matters
Workforce Planning, Reporting & Insights
Monitor workforce metrics including headcount, labour costs, overtime, turnover, and productivity
Support workforce planning, budgeting, and forecasting
Analyse data and use numbers to identify trends, risks, and opportunities
Translate workforce data into clear, practical insights to support business decisions
Workforce Transitions & Change
Lead restructures, redundancies, and workforce changes in a compliant and practical manner
Support leaders through organisational change while minimising risk and maintaining engagement
Conduct exit interviews and analyse insights to identify trends and improvement opportunities
Compliance & HR Governance
Ensure compliance with the Fair Work Act, NES, EBAs, and Modern Awards
Oversee employment contracts, policies, and employee records
Provide guidance on EBA and Award interpretation
Monitor employee relations trends, turnover data, and workforce metrics to inform proactive actions
Support the implementation and ongoing management of HR policies, procedures, and best practice frameworks
Maintain consistent and compliant HR practices
Lead HR system improvements and optimisation initiatives
Improve data integrity and reporting capability
Leverage technology and AI tools to improve efficiency and reduce manual work
Leadership
Lead and develop the P&C operations team
Drive accountability, performance, and capability
Key Qualifications & Experience
Bachelor's degree in human resources, Business, or a related discipline (or equivalent experience)
8–12+ years of HR experience, including senior and leadership roles
Minimum 5+ years' experience leading HR or operational teams
Strong experience across HR operations, employee relations, and industrial relations
Demonstrated experience managing EBAs and complex industrial relations matters
Strong knowledge of Australian employment legislation (Fair Work Act, Modern Awards, NES)
Proven ability to partner with senior leaders and influence business decisions
Advanced analytical capability, with experience using workforce data and reporting tools (e.g. Power BI)
Strong commercial acumen with understanding of workforce cost drivers
Excellent communication skills, with the ability to influence, challenge, and provide clear guidance
Experience in manufacturing, mining, or similar operational environments preferred
AHRI membership or certification
Experience in transformation or growing organizations
Experience leading HR systems or process improvement initiatives

About us
AtMayfield, we areproudly Australian owned & operated since 1936and pride ourselves on adding value through innovation and collaboration. This approach, combined with our commitment to our people and partners, allows us to beleaders in the design and manufactureof one of a kind and modular switchboard, control systems and transportable substation solutions to meet safety and reliability demands of critical electrical infrastructure across the nation.
Our values proudly focus on safety, partnerships, people, innovation, integrity, quality and community. We celebrate diversity, provide an inclusive working environment with great team culture, and we care about the wellbeing of our people.
